What is Lake Como?

Lake Como is a large lake in the north of Italy, approx. 90 minutes from Milan Malpensa Airport.

Once described as the “most beautiful lake in the world“, Lake Como is a popular retreat for the rich and famous: George Clooney, Madonna, and Gianni Versace all own houses on the shores of the lake. It is surrounded by snow-capped mountains and many idyllic villages, such as Bellagio or Como hug its shores. This makes Lake Como much more than “just” a lake: it is one of the most dramatic, romantic, and magical landscapes in the world. In short: the ideal place to celebrate a destination wedding.

Scenic beauty apart, Lake Como’s shores are also dotted with beautiful villas and palazzos, which date back to the 18th century, when Lake Como was (already) a popular retreat for aristocrats and the wealthy. Many of these villas are now available as wedding venues.

In popular culture, Lake Como rose to fame as a backdrop to popular movies, such as Star Wars, Casino Royale, House of Gucci, or Ocean’s 12, and music videos, such as Gwen Stefani’s Cool.

Wedding Cost Factors: General Tips

1. Wedding Venue Selection

Your wedding venue is one of the most significant costs in your wedding budget.

Lake Como offers a wide range of venues, from opulent villas to charming lakeside gardens. For those seeking luxury, venues like Villa Balbiano and Grand Hotel Tremezzo provide an exquisite setting with high-end amenities, but come with a premium price tag.

On the other hand, more intimate and lesser-known venues in the hills or smaller villages around the lake offer equally romantic backdrops at a fraction of the cost.

In our opinion, it is essential to visit potential venues and to understand the inclusions of the rental fee to make an informed decision.

2. Wedding Vendor Services

Hiring top-notch vendors is key to ensuring a seamless and stress-free wedding experience. Costs can vary significantly based on the quality and reputation of the vendors you choose.

High-end wedding planners, photographers, florists, and caterers are readily available around Lake Como, but their services come at a premium.

For those on a tighter budget, consider local vendors who may offer competitive rates without compromising on quality. Always review portfolios and conduct thorough interviews to find vendors who align with your vision and budget.

3. Accommodation for Guests

Lake Como’s popularity as a tourist destination means there are numerous accommodation options for your guests.

Luxury hotels like Villa d’Este offer an unforgettable stay but at a higher price. Alternatively, charming bed and breakfasts or vacation rentals can provide comfortable lodging at more affordable rates.

Booking accommodations well in advance and negotiating group rates can also help manage costs. Additionally, consider arranging transportation for your guests to ensure convenience and enhance their overall experience.

4. Legal and Symbolic Ceremonies

When planning a wedding at Lake Como, it’s important to understand the distinction between legal and symbolic ceremonies.

Legal ceremonies require specific paperwork, translations, and potentially a local interpreter, which can add to the overall cost and complexity.

Many couples opt for a symbolic ceremony in Italy after completing the legal formalities in their home country. This approach simplifies the process and allows for more flexibility in choosing the ceremony location and format.

Celebrating a traditional wedding at Lake Como costs between US$50,000 and US$150,000. For a full cost breakdown of a US$100k wedding at Villa del Balbianello, visit our blog post here.

The exact amount primarily depends on:

1. The Wedding Venue:
Lake Como’s wedding venues range from the affordable to the ultra-luxurious. Villa Balbiano, for example, can get as expensive as US$60,000 (rent per day) for just the venue. On the other hand, Villa Erba charges just one-third, at approx. US$25,000 per day.

Finding the right venue for your budget is the first step towards celebrating a more traditional wedding at Lake Como.

2. The Duration of Your Celebration:
A destination wedding is typically a multi-day affair. On day 1, the celebrations start with a rehearsal or casual get-together. Day 2 is your big day and includes the ceremony and celebration. Day 3 concludes the celebrations with a wedding brunch.

A destination wedding gives you the liberty to adjust this schedule to your liking. Some couples decide to have only a single-day event, for example. They leave the other days open for guests to enjoy and relax or offer organized activities (wine tasting, hiking, a visit to Bellagio, etc.) to spend time with their guests in a more casual setting.

3. The Size of Your Guest List:
Of course, the size of your guest list will have a major impact on the cost of your wedding. Expect to spend between US$1,000 to US$2,000 per guest (all-in).

4. Catering:
The two most important expenses at any wedding are the venue and catering. Budget between US$250 and US$350 per person for catering (not including drinks).

Traditional Wedding: Cost Breakdown

For a traditional wedding at Lake Como, with a budget ranging from $50,000 to $100,000, your expenses will generally break down as follows:

Venue Rental: $10,000 to $30,000
Catering: $250 to $350 per person
Photography and Videography: $5,000 to $10,000
Floral Arrangements: $3,000 to $7,000
Entertainment (Band or DJ): $2,000 to $5,000
Wedding Attire: $5,000 to $15,000
Miscellaneous (Transportation, Favors, etc.): $5,000 to $10,000

These estimates can vary based on the specific choices you make. We advise you to create a detailed budget spreadsheet to track expenses and ensure you stay within budget. Our blog contains a free budgeting template that gives you everything you need to track your expenses.

A small and intimate Lake Como wedding can be organized for as little as US$25,000. To stay within such a tight budget, there are some guidelines to follow, however.

First, spend your money wisely.
With a US$20,000 budget and 20 guests, the average budget per guest is US$1,000, which is certainly on the lower end for Lake Como and just enough to celebrate a wedding. Try to go for an off-season date where rates for venues are substantially lower.

Second, given the size of your budget and guest list, it is not necessary, nor recommended to hire a wedding planner. Your budget is too small to afford them.

Third, pick a venue that is just the right size. Filter through our list of wedding venues to find villas and palazzos at US$10k or less. Alternatively, browse Airbnb’s for villas or find restaurants on the shores of Lake Como that can be privatized for a wedding.

Last, be creative! A small wedding with a small budget does require you to be more hands-on in your planning. Ask your guests to help with decorations or flowers. Source food and drinks from a restaurant rather than a wedding caterer. Unfortunately, anything with the word “wedding” in it is usually double the cost.

And remember: Lake Como’s beauty means that you do not need much else to make your wedding feel special!

Last but not least, you can also elope at Lake Como.

Elope used to mean “to run away and secretly get married”. Nowadays, it is more frequently used to mean a very small destination wedding.

An elopement has a smaller overall cost than a wedding. Some elopements such as the one shown in the video below, have no guests at all. Only the groom and bride (and a photographer and videographer) “witness” the event.

This is a beautiful idea for all those who want to tie the knot without the hassle of managing guests, having to fulfill other people’s expectations, or being bound by tradition. An elopement is solely about you and the very few people that matter most to you.

One word of advice for those who wish to elope. Do not get legally married in Italy. Celebrate your civil wedding at home and marry symbolically in Italy. Even though an Italian marriage certificate is recognized outside of Italy, you will require translations, apostilles, etc. to register your marriage in your home country.

Websites such as Elope Italy or Somewhere Crazy offer elopement packages for Lake Como. Starting from less than US$10,000 (all-in), they include everything to get legally or symbolically married at Lake Como.
